Trunks of some of the aged tree species appear to be composed of several fused trunks. It it a physiological or anatomical abnormality ? Explain in detail.

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

It is anatomical. It is an abnormal type of secondary growth. Where a regular vascular cambium or cork cambium is not formed in its normal position. In case of old tree trunks, anomalous secondary growth produces cortical and medullary vascular bundles.
Thus, the additional or accessory vascular bundles given appearnce of several fused trunks.
